This position is an integral member of the Inflight Team within the Customer Experience Division, based at Logan International Airport (BOS). The ideal candidate is energized by a fast-paced, dynamic environment and possesses a passion for safety, teamwork, leadership, and delivering a quality product to customers, frontline teams, and vendors.
The Crew Manager, Inflight is responsible for collaborating interdepartmentally to enhance reliability, engage with crews, problem-solve operational issues, and support continuous improvements. This role directly supports flight crews during operations, contributing to the timely departure of passengers.

Qualifications:
- Bachelor’s degree in a related field or equivalent experience/training.
- Minimum of 3+ years of relevant experience.
- Ability to work variable shifts, including early mornings, late nights, weekends, and holidays, with flexibility for operational needs.
- Must be able to work on-site at the assigned base/location (BOS).
- Current Flight Service, Passenger Service, or Passenger Sales experience is preferred.
- An understanding of working with a contract labor group is desirable.
Skills, Licenses, and Certifications:
- Proven ability to coach, develop, and lead a team of Flight Attendants.
- Excellent interpersonal, planning, and organizational skills.
- Capability to meet qualifications to train as a flight attendant to enhance team leadership.
- A neat, well-groomed appearance reflecting a positive impression.
- Strong service orientation.
- Ability to push/pull force of up to 60 pounds.
- Capacity to successfully perform the physical requirements of the job, including emergency evacuation drills.
- Ability to effectively coordinate multiple projects simultaneously.
- Must pass FAA criminal background checks for unescorted access privileges to airport security identification display areas (SIDA), if applicable.
- Ability to secure appropriate airport authority and/or US Customs security badges.
- Must pass a U.S. Department of Transportation (DOT) mandated drug test.
